13:04:17 <irenab> #startmeeting pci_passthrough 13:04:18 <openstack> Meeting started Tue Aug 12 13:04:17 2014 UTC and is due to finish in 60 minutes. The chair is irenab. Information about MeetBot at http://wiki.debian.org/MeetBot. 13:04:19 <openstack>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 13:04:21 <openstack> The meeting name has been set to 'pci_passthrough' 13:04:43 <irenab> hi 13:04:54 <irenab> baoli sent email that he cannot make it today 13:05:23 <beagles> `o 13:05:44 <heyongli> 2 patches in, great 13:05:52 <irenab> cool! 13:05:52 <sadasu> I seemed to have missed that email 13:06:27 <irenab> I am back after a week off, still trying to catch up 13:07:16 <irenab> Does anyone has some updates? 13:07:47 <sadasu> I am uploading a new patchset today based on current review comments 13:08:10 <sadasu> folks can take a look after this update 13:08:26 <irenab> sadasu: Did you do some code reuse of NIC switch MD? 13:08:34 <heyongli> great, i will check tomorrow, 13:08:43 <irenab> sadsu: will review as well 13:08:59 <sadasu> irenab: lets talk about the code reuse 13:09:13 <irenab> sadsu: sure 13:09:18 <sadasu> we briefly touched upon it the last meeting 13:09:26 <sadasu> not in detail since you weren't there 13:09:54 <irenab> sadasu: sorry, didn't check the log yet... 13:10:38 <sadasu> so, in the current set of diffs cisco mech driver is inheriting from MechanismDriver 13:10:50 <sadasu> the plan is to go with this until Juno-3 13:11:30 <irenab> sadasu: so for now there is no reuse, right? 13:11:37 <sadasu> right after Juno 3, we can commit changes to srio-nic-switch mech driver (which is going to be the common one) 13:11:50 <sadasu> to make it more common based on discussion in the ML 13:12:25 <sadasu> my mech driver will inherit from this common srio-nic-switch class as a subsequent bugfix again right after Juno-3 13:12:37 <irenab> sadasu: to save time for everyone, I'll take a look at the last meeting log and maybe comment on review, ok? 13:13:07 <irenab> sadasu: generally sounds reasonable 13:14:13 <sadasu> irenab: it is clear that we can re-use code...but just doing that as a seperate change 13:14:56 <sadasu> hoping to make it easier on the reviewers since there is already a lot to come upto speed on here 13:15:30 <irenab> sadsu: agree, probably most of the features are implemented in the same maner, number of L2 agents is good example... 13:16:15 <sadasu> the common code is about 25% of the changes so it doesn't look like a replica of sriov-nic-switch 13:16:48 <irenab> sadasu: so for the code review of cisco MD, I am assuming no code reuse 13:17:24 <sadasu> correct....code re-use will be a bugfix within Juno cycle 13:17:37 <sadasu> r u fine with that? 13:18:38 <irenab> sadasu: I am fine with it. 13:18:50 <sadasu> irenab: cool & thanks 13:19:23 <irenab> heyongli: Did you have a chance to check the sriov-nic-switch for Intel NICs? 13:21:21 <irenab> seems that nova patches makeing a lot of progress. 13:21:38 <heyongli> irenab, our CI under internal testing 13:21:53 <heyongli> do you tested? 13:22:22 <heyongli> if not, i need set up a manual testing bed. 13:22:53 <irenab> heyongli: let me know if there are some issues. Yes, we tested and there is a CI job we run under Mellanox External Testing for this. Currenlty take the nova patches and apply them as part of the devstack deployment 13:23:12 <heyongli> irenab, if you have sriov verify step by step guide, could you share it with me? 13:23:58 <irenab> heyongli: actually, for now its is just port-create with vnic_type=direct, then nova boot 13:24:04 <heyongli> there are some neutron part setting up, if you can share, that's great help to me 13:24:15 <heyongli> ok, got 13:26:14 <heyongli> any other topic? 13:27:09 <irenab> heyongli: Ok, will check 13:28:03 <irenab> heyongli: I can send you the neutron config we use 13:28:11 <heyongli> thanks. 13:28:55 <irenab> no more topics for me right now, maybe we needto prepare the list of next issues to discuss next meeting, probably need tempest, documentations, ... 13:29:35 <irenab> I'll start the list on meeting wiki page, will send to all to update 13:29:50 <heyongli> thanks irenab 13:30:09 <heyongli> then end meeting today? 13:30:17 <sadasu> yes..makes sense 13:30:38 <irenab> great, see you next week and on reviews 13:30:43 <irenab> #endmeeting